    Is there a way to change my car from BAR to PSI?

    One bar is one atmosphere at sea level. (14.5psi) This is the weight of the column of air all the way up to space in 1 square inch. (We learned atmospheric pressure even in US schools)

    MCU fails for the second time

    Yes black screen can mean a corrupted filesystem, or worn-out flash. ext3 isn't fully journaled like ext4 or zfs, so it can get damaged by a reset (two-finger-salute) or by disconnecting the battery at the wrong instant. Hell, even ext4 is touchy. Lots of bad MCUs are floating around and the...

  50. Dr. Smoke

    Why didn't the Model S cross the stream?

    Newer models have a valve on top of the inverter that reduces the chances of letting water in. But, the pack has vents which can and do sometimes let water in. And, if your pack has ever (ever) been removed, there is a design problem where the gasket around the pack's main contacts to the car...
